The Motorcycle Brake by Wire System Market was valued at USD 113.56 million in 2023, expected to reach USD 117.21 million in 2024, and is projected to grow at a CAGR of 26.45%, to USD 587.33 million by 2030.
The scope of the Motorcycle Brake by Wire System encompasses the technological advancement in braking systems, replacing traditional hydraulic or mechanical systems with electronic controls. Defined by their precision and lightness, these systems enhance braking performance and safety, becoming increasingly necessary as motorcycles incorporate more sophisticated technology for improved rider control and experience. They find application in electric and hybrid motorcycles, as well as high-performance racing bikes, where precise control can significantly enhance ride quality and safety. The end-use scope is broad, extending from everyday commuting bikes to high-end sports motorcycles, driven by growing consumer demand for safety, efficiency, and durability.

Market insights reveal that the primary growth drivers include increased focus on rider safety, advancements in automotive electronics, and the push towards electric vehicles. There are numerous opportunities, particularly in regions with stringent safety regulations and environmental norms driving the adoption of smarter technology. Key opportunities lie in emerging markets where motorcycle sales are robust, and there is significant room for technological upgrades. However, the market faces challenges such as high initial costs, limited consumer awareness, and technical complexities that can deter manufacturers from adopting these systems. Additionally, the ongoing chip shortage impacting the electronics industry could pose temporary hurdles.
For innovation, businesses could explore integrating these systems with AI and IoT for predictive maintenance and enhanced rider interaction. Research could also focus on reducing costs through improved supply chain logistics and increasing system adaptability to a wider range of motorcycle models. The market's nature is moderately competitive with significant potential for growth, underscored by collaborations between technology firms and traditional motorcycle manufacturers. Keeping an eye on regulatory changes, global demand shifts, and investing in consumer education will be crucial in capitalizing on the growth potential of Motorcycle Brake by Wire Systems.
